Do Pay Attention to Small Leaks
A ruptured pipeline does not take place overnight. Typically, there are warnings that show you have deteriorated pipelines in your house. You might discover bubbling paint, peeling wallpaper, water streaks, water spots, or leaking audios behind the wall surfaces. At some point, this pipeline will certainly break. Preferably, you should not wait for things to intensify. Have your plumbing fixed prior to it causes massive damage.
Do Not Panic in Case of a Ruptured Pipe
When it comes to water damage, timing is crucial. Thus, if a pipe ruptureds in your home, quickly closed off your major water shutoff to reduce off the source. Call a credible water damage repair professional for support.

Are You Currently Experiencing a Water Disaster?
If you’re in the middle of a water intrusion disaster, here are some important dos and don’ts to follow:
Don’ts:
Safety first! Do not enter a room with standing water until the electricity has been turned off! A regular household vacuum should never be used to pick up water. Never use electrical appliance if standing on a wet floor or carpet. Leave visible mold alone. Dos:
Call a water mitigation professional as soon as possible. Mold and other damage can begin within hours of a water intrusion. Mop and blot up as much water as possible. Remove non-attached floor coverings and mats but leave wall-to-wall carpeting removal to a pro. If there are window coverings like draperies that touch the water, loop them through a hanger and put them up on the rod. Remove wet cushions to dry and wipe down soaked furniture. Move valuables like paintings, photos, and art objects to a dry location. Books should be left tightly packed on shelves until it’s determined if they need specialized drying.
